Thanks, Web11 apr. 2024 · To print a comment list, follow these steps if you are using Word 97 or Word 2000: Select Print from the File menu. Word displays the Print dialog box. Using the Print What drop-down list, select Comments. Click on OK. Beginning with Word 2002, Microsoft significantly changed the way that Word handles document "markup."

Web24 apr. 2024 · Method 2: Hide Styles. First of all, open “Styles” window by clicking the arrow button in “Styles” group. For example, if we choose to hide endnotes this time, right click on the “Endnote Text” style. Choose “Modify”. In “Modify Style” box, click “Format” and choose “Font”. In “Font” box, check “Hidden” box ...
